Automated content optimization refers to the process where AI-driven systems analyze live data to modify and improve website content without human intervention. These systems continuously monitor user behavior, engagement metrics, and contextual factors to make real-time adjustments, ensuring that the content remains relevant, personalized, and effective.

Real-time data encompasses the latest information generated by user interactions, device sensors, social media trends, and more. Integrating this data into content strategies allows websites to respond immediately to changing circumstances. For example, if a sudden spike in interest occurs around a product, the system can adjust the content to highlight relevant features or offers.
This agility leads to increased user engagement, longer site visits, and higher conversion rates. It also helps maintain competitiveness in rapidly evolving markets, where static content quickly becomes outdated.
